Match Overview

Mananchaya Sawangkaew and Sijia Wei are set to meet at the Singapore on January 27, 2025 in a hard-court singles match. Sawangkaew enters with a 16–13 record on hard courts in 2025, while Wei has posted a 21–14 mark on hard courts this season. Elo ratings suggest a modest statistical edge for Sawangkaew, but the gap is not overwhelming. In their head-to-head history, Wei leads 3–1 over Sawangkaew.

Recent form has been mixed for both players, with Sawangkaew and Wei alternating wins and losses across their last few singles outings.
